summ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orJoshH1002019-11-13 12:13:40 -0700
committerJoshH1002019-11-13 12:13:40 -0700
commitd00efb7e69da0c2a68bed7ba8ff9269cdfc2247f (patch)
treed01160adf924145064fbfd39f6428178dbab01c4
downloadaur-d00efb7e69da0c2a68bed7ba8ff9269cdfc2247f.tar.gz
initial commit
-rw-r--r--.SRCINFO30
-rw-r--r--PKGBUILD33
2 files changed, 63 insertions, 0 deletions
diff --git a/.SRCINFO b/.SRCINFO
new file mode 100644
index 000000000000..b29cfe5e7936
--- /dev/null
+++ b/.SRCINFO
@@ -0,0 +1,30 @@
+pkgbase = madagascar
+ pkgdesc = Automatic Rule-Based Time Tracker
+ pkgver = 3.0.1
+ pkgrel = 1
+ url = http://ahay.org/
+ arch = i686
+ arch = x86_64
+ license = GPL2
+ makedepends = scons
+ makedepends = libtirpc
+ makedepends = libtirpc-compat
+ depends = libtirpc
+ depends = ffmpeg
+ depends = libxaw
+ depends = cario
+ depends = fftw
+ depends = netpbm
+ depends = gd
+ depends = openmpi
+ depends = glu
+ depends = freeglut
+ depends = suitesparse
+ depends = python
+ noextract = madagascar.tar.gz
+ options = strip
+ source = madagascar.tar.gz::https://sourceforge.net/projects/rsf/files/madagascar/madagascar-3.0/madagascar-3.0.1.tar.gz/download
+ md5sums = a87a6f7f5ba552cd251b1588048844bf
+
+pkgname = madagascar
+
diff --git a/PKGBUILD b/PKGBUILD
new file mode 100644
index 000000000000..32ee4bfbfd6f
--- /dev/null
+++ b/PKGBUILD
@@ -0,0 +1,33 @@
+# Maintainer: Josh Hoffer
+pkgname=madagascar
+pkgver=3.0.1
+pkgrel=1
+pkgdesc="Automatic Rule-Based Time Tracker"
+url=http://ahay.org/
+license=('GPL2')
+arch=('i686' 'x86_64')
+depends=('libtirpc' 'ffmpeg' 'libxaw' 'cario' 'fftw' 'netpbm' 'gd'
+'openmpi' 'glu' 'freeglut' 'suitesparse' 'python')
+makedepends=('scons' 'libtirpc' 'libtirpc-compat')
+options=('strip')
+source=("$pkgname.tar.gz::https://sourceforge.net/projects/rsf/files/madagascar/madagascar-3.0/madagascar-3.0.1.tar.gz/download")
+noextract=("$pkgname.tar.gz")
+
+prepare() {
+ cd "$srcdir"
+ bsdtar -xf $pkgname.tar.gz --strip-components=1
+}
+
+build() {
+ cd ${srcdir}
+ # Investigate additional bindings
+ export LINKFLAGS="-ltirpc"
+ ./configure --prefix=${pkgdir}/usr/
+ sed -i "s/^LINKFLAGS.*/LINKFLAGS = ['-pthread', '-fopenmp', '-ltirpc']/g" config.py
+ make
+}
+
+package() {
+ make install
+}
+md5sums=('a87a6f7f5ba552cd251b1588048844bf')